AUSN Cooperation Agreement with Royal Institution of Singapore


American University of Sovereign Nations (AUSN) is honored to have signed an Academic Cooperation Agreement with Royal Institution of Singapore, which like Accredited Universities of Sovereign Nations is another global accreditation agency.

Royal Institution Pte Ltd (200307961C) was incorporated in 2003 and registered with the Accounting and Corporate Regulatory Authority of Singapore (ACRA) - formerly known as the Registry of Companies and Businesses of Singapore (ROC or RCB).

Royal Institution, Singapore (RI) is a global, multidisciplinary, professional membership and accrediting institution that aims to level the playing field and be the premier platform for smarter and more effective global networking, connecting education, business, commerce and industries and facilitating collaboration, innovation and perpetual learning for more opportunities, benefits, privileges, global recognition and status.

Royal Institution, together with its more than 222 constituent Royal Institutes, creates boundless opportunities for its members to participate in RI global seminars, congresses, conferences and present and publish research papers in RI International Research Journals of Singapore worldwide.

RI recognises the talents and the achievements of academicians, architects, artists, businessmen, chief compliance officers, chief executive officers, chief financial officers, dentists, diplomats, doctors, educators, engineers, entrepreneurs, graduates, hoteliers, innovators, intellectuals, inventors, lawyers, leaders, legal advocates, linguists, nurses, paralegals, philanthropists, pioneers, planners, professionals, researchers, scientists, students, surgeons, therapists, and all individuals who deserve recognition. RI confers on its members a globally recognised status.

Royal Institution is guided and directed by a Governing Council, supported by an International Advisory Council, and assisted by Honorary Boards which comprise of members, all of whom have extensive professional experience, doctoral and/or post doctoral qualifications. Royal Institution currently has a regional office in the Philippines and liaison officers in Australia, Canada, Kingdom of Saudi Arabia, Malaysia, Republic of Maldives, People’s Republic of China, United Kingdom and United States of America.
